Veeze has fans dreaming about what a potential J. Cole collaboration would sound like after he posed for a photo with the Dreamville honcho.

Earlier this week, the Ganger rapper was a special guest at Lil Baby’s birthday bash at State Farm Arena in Atlanta, where J. Cole performed, and the two ran into one another backstage.

Veeze later shared a collection of photos from the event, captioning the photo dump: “HavinAgoodmerrychristmas.”

Fans flooded the post’s comments section to express their hope that a team-up with J. Cole was on the way in 2024.

“A Cole and Veeze collab would feed families,” one person wrote while another said, “You n cole is legendary man!”

J. Cole has been ripping through features all of 2023 and if he keeps that energy going into 2024, the idea of Cole and Veeze teaming up isn’t that far-fetched.

Veeze leveled up in 2023 with the release of his album Ganger,which caught the eye of another rap heavyweight in JAY-Z.

Hov showed love to up-and-coming Detroit native,  among other newcomers, but including “Not A Drill” on his end-of-year “Couple Songs of ’23” playlist on TIDAL.

Back in September, on the heels of Ganger‘s arrival, the Detroit lyricist launched his imprint Navy Wavy through Warner Records with his manager Terrence “Snake” Hawkins. Their partnership caught the attention of Warner’s CEO and Co-Chairman Aaron Bay-Schuck.
